Today we are talking about AI in EDU, how it can provide efficiencies, and how you might start using it today with guests Brian Piper & Mike Miles . We’ll also cover External Entities as our module of the week.

  • Brief description:
    • Have you ever wanted to connect your Drupal website to an external data source, to include their datasets into the presentation of your Drupal-managed content? There’s a module for that
  • Module name/project name:
  • Brief history
    • How old: created in May 2015 by attiks, though the most recent release is by Colan Schwartz (colan), a fellow Canadian
    • Versions available: 8.x-2.0-beta1 and 3.0.0-beta4, the latter of which supports Drupal 10 and 11
  • Maintainership
    • Actively maintained, latest release was less than a month ago
    • Security coverage (though technically needs a stable release
    • Test coverage
    • Documentation: user guide
    • Number of open issues: 77 open issues, 3 of which are bugs against the 3.x branch, though one is marked fixed now
  • Usage stats:
    • 679 sites
  • Module features and usage
    • The External Entities module lets you map fields from external data sources to fields on a “virtual” entity in Drupal. This allows for external data to be used with Drupal’s powerful features like Views, Entity Queries, or Search API as well as use your local Drupal site’s theme to theme data from an external source
    • The module does provide a time-based caching layer for external entities, but you can also implement a more custom cache expiration logic through custom code
    • External entities can also have annotations, essentially Drupal-managed information that will be associated with the external entity, and accessed as a normal field through all Drupal field operations. This could allow you to have Drupal-based comments on information from a different website, for example
    • There is a sizeable ecosystem of companion modules, to help you connect to different kinds of external storage, as to help you aggregate data from multiple sources
    • In my Drupal career I’ve worked on a number of higher ed websites, and the ability to display externally-managed data is a pretty common requirement, either from an HRIS system to show staff and faculty data, or a courseware solution like Banner. I thought this would be an interesting tangent to today’s topic
